Understanding Flavor: A Multisensory Experience

Flavor is a multisensory experience, influenced by taste, aroma, texture, and even visual cues. The intricate balance of sweet, sour, salty, bitter, and umami is the foundation upon which chefs build complex flavor profiles. By understanding the chemical compounds responsible for these sensory perceptions, chefs can predict and manipulate the outcomes of flavor combinations.

The Role of Chemistry in Culinary Innovation

Advanced chemistry plays a crucial role in creating novel flavor pairings. Volatile molecules responsible for aroma and flavor can be scientifically paired to enhance or contrast one another. Techniques such as spherification, fermentation, and emulsification, borrowing principles from chemistry, allow chefs to manipulate the molecular structure of ingredients to innovate textural and flavor experiences.

Techniques for Achieving Flavor Fusion

  1. Experiment with Pairings: Use analytical tools like the flavor-pairing graph to identify compatible ingredients based on shared chemical compounds.

  2. Embrace Cross-Cultural Inspirations: Explore the traditional cuisines of various cultures to find unexpected yet complementary combinations.

  3. Incorporate Modernist Techniques: Employ techniques like sous-vide, freeze-drying, and liquid nitrogen to alter textures and emphasize flavor intensities.

Case Studies: Successful Fusion in Contemporary Cuisine

  • Molecular Gastronomy: Pioneered by chefs like Heston Blumenthal, molecular gastronomy employs scientific techniques to deconstruct and reinvent dishes, resulting in avant-garde dining experiences.

  • Fusion Cuisine: Chefs such as Roy Yamaguchi merge elements of European, Asian, and Pacific Island cooking, creating entirely new genres of cuisine.
